WORS #6 Firecracker

Eau Claire, WI
Sunday July 11, 2010
by: Ryan Shiroma

I had pretty high hopes for WORS #6 after having a pretty good race two weeks ago at WORS #5.  The course had a long and fast leadout.  I didn’t have a very good start so I sat pretty far back in the field heading into the first single track section.  I was hoping to make up some ground in the single track but a couple crashes had us moving at walking pace.  Once we got going again I found myself behind a guy who was hammering the open sections and crashing or clipping out in every technical section.  I’d catch him or pass him in the single track but end up behind him again in the next section.  On the second lap he finally crashed hard enough for me to drop him.  I was going fast in the single track but really struggling in the open sections which was frustrating.  To add to the frustration I was taken out by a confused racer in an open section on the last lap.  I hit the ground pretty hard and it took me a little while to gather myself and find my sunglasses.  I got going again but something didn’t seem right about my helmet straps.  I pushed on anyways and managed a pretty sad 9th place.  At the finish I took off my helmet and found that it was broken.  Turned out to be a pretty expensive race.  It wasn’t until the next day that I really felt the effects of the crash.  It’s three days later and I’m still pretty sore.  Hopefully I can put this one behind me and get ready for the next one.
